Output 58ef350d926b20db56c85ab589906dc75d230e69880d3c925c60e851c8b78f70:95

value
522738
script pubkey
OP_0 OP_PUSHBYTES_20 91e7dfe11a9d63dfd73da863056abdc78383ed2b
address
bc1qj8nalcg6n43al4ea4p3s264ac7pc8mftnzr9aw
transaction
58ef350d926b20db56c85ab589906dc75d230e69880d3c925c60e851c8b78f70
spent
true